Rusticated stone

Construction; Architecture

Stonework, sometimes roughly finished, distinguished by having the joints deeply sunk.

Saddle

Construction; Architecture

A small ridged roof designed to carry water away from the back side of a chimney.

Bay

Construction; Architecture

Buildings are often divided into repetitive elements, or bays, defined by the space between two horizontal beams, or pairs of vertical columns.

Sash

Construction; Architecture

An individual window unit (comprised of rails, stiles, lites, muntins) that fits inside the window frame.

Bay window

Construction; Architecture

A set of two or more windows that protrude out from the wall. The window is moved away from the wall to provide more light and wider views..

Bead moulding

Construction; Architecture

A small, cylindrical moulding enriched with ornaments resembling a string of beads.
